As a member of our PSR Team you will help make a tangible contribution to lifting the protective security capability of New Zealand organisations.
Day to day you will advise on complex ideas in a clear and concise way to a diverse range of stakeholders. You will analyse a range of information to inform decision making and you will drive the development and delivery of PSR policy and guidance.
You will have the following attributes:
- Demonstrate a sound level of critical thinking, policy analysis, and evaluation
- Ability to communicate effectively to a wide range of audiences, including Ministers
- Highly engaged, proactive and action-orientated to deliver successful outcomes
- Ability to work well with a range of stakeholders
- Capability to lead projects, with senior support, and manage a large number of tasks to achieve an overall outcome.
You may already have knowledge or experience working within the security sector but this is not a necessity, as your proven ability to think critically, analyse and advise effectively will stand you in good stead.

To be eligible for employment within the NZIC you must have been a NZ citizen for at least 10 years. Alternatively you must hold a current NZ Residency Class Visa and ideally have been a citizen of UK, USA, Canada or Australia for at least 10 years.
You must be able to obtain and maintain a Top Secret Special (TSS) security clearance. Ordinarily to obtain this level of clearance candidates must have a 15 year checkable background in countries where meaningful and reliable checks can be undertaken. Where requisite checks are unable to be made, the candidate application may not be able to be progressed.
